Grade Logic Control: Ascending Control
W h e n the PCM determines that the vehicle is climbing a hill in the D and D3 positions, the system extends the
engagement area of 2nd gear, 3rd gear, and 4th gear to prevent the transmission f r o m frequently shifting between
2nd and 3rd gears, between 3rd and 4th gears, and between 4th and 5th gears, so the vehicle can run s m o o t h and
have more power w h e n needed.
NOTE: Shift c o m m a n d s stored in the PCM between 2nd and 3rd gears, between 3rd and 4th gears, and between 4th
and 5th gears, enable the PCM to automatically select the most suitable gear according to the m a g n i t u d e of a gradient.

Grade Logic Control: Descending Control
W h e n the PCM determines that the vehicle is going d o w n a hill in the D and D3 positions, the shift-up speed f r o m 4th
to 5th gear, 3rd to 4th gear, and f r o m 2nd to 3rd (when the throttle is closed) becomes faster than the set speed for flat
road driving to w i d e n the 4th gear, 3rd gear, and 2nd gear driving areas. This, in c o m b i n a t i o n w i t h engine braking
f r o m the deceleration lock-up, achieves s m o o t h driving w h e n the vehicle is descending. There are three descending
modes w i t h different 4th gear driving areas, 3rd gear driving areas and 2nd gear driving areas according to the
magnitude of a gradient stored in the PCM. W h e n the vehicle is in 5th or 4th gear and y o u are decelerating w h i l e
applying the brakes on a steep hill, the transmission w i l l d o w n s h i f t to a lower gear. W h e n y o u accelerate, the
transmission w i l l then return to a higher gear.

Deceleration Control
W h e n the vehicle goes around a corner and needs to decelerate first and then accelerate, the PCM sets the data for
deceleration control to reduce the n u m b e r of t i m e s the transmission shifts. W h e n the vehicle is decelerating f r o m
speeds above 27 m p h (43 km/h), the PCM shifts the transmission f r o m 5th or 4th to 2nd earlier than n o r m a l to cope
w i t h u p c o m i n g acceleration.
